To travel by train, people buy tickets for the station from where they start their journey and the station till which they travel. According to the rules of the railways, passengers can travel between these stations only.
But this question also comes in the mind of many people. If a passenger gets down at another station after taking a ticket of the first station in the train, then how much fine can be imposed on such a passenger. So let us tell you that the railways impose fine on such people according to the ticket.
That is, if a passenger does not get down at the booked destination station but gets down at the next station. Then a fine of Rs 250 can be imposed on him. Along with this, he also has to pay the fare till the next station as a fine.
